Five-year network management plan sets out priorities for Oxfordshire’s roads
Reducing pressure on Oxfordshire’s road network and enabling local traffic improvements are key objectives of the network management plan for 2023 – 28. Oxfordshire County Council’s cabinet today adopted the plan, which includes hierarchies of road users and priority for roadworks in line with its Local Transport and Connectivity Plan and its commitment to climate action. Wellingborough town centre highways improvements to start soon in North Northamptonshire
Highways improvements in Wellingborough town centre will start next week. Kier Highways, working in partnership with North Northamptonshire Council will carry out the works to upgrade the traffic signal equipment, refresh white lining and reinstate block paving in Cannon Street and Alma Street in the town. Cumbria’s £150m Carlisle Southern Link Road goes out to tender in September
Cumbria County Council aims to award the contract for the building of the 8km Southern Link Road road in March 2023. Work on the Carlisle Southern Link Road, which the council estimates will cost around £150m, was originally set to begin this spring. <strong>Kier Highways trials Hydrogen powered generator on its Windy Harbour project</strong>
Kier Highways is trialling an innovative, hydrogen-powered fuel cell at its National Highways A585 Windy Harbour to Skippool site in Poulton-le-Fylde, Lancashire. The project is in collaboration with Hydrologiq and is the first hydrogen 110kVA generator deployment undertaken by Kier Highways.
